No Jacket. 1st Edition. 3 p.l., 279 p. 20 cm.OCLC 2328101 LCCN 39027874 ; LC PS3511.O4113 ; tan and brown cloth ; no dustjacket ; SIGNED presentation by author on title page to Dr. Jesse Oliver Purvis (1880-1962), a physician at Annapolis Maryland and member of the Board at St. Joseph's Hospital, where he worked extensively as the college physician for St. John's College in Annapolis. Dr. Purvis's bookplate is found on the front endpaper ; Plot: Lovely Faith Yardley's betrothal to a man from the north is abruptly followed by murder -- and more murder. Transformed by terror, quaint and beautiful Williamsburg, Virginia waits for the killer to strike again, and wonders: This time, will it be Faith Yardley herself' "Another of Leslie Ford's ace items in murder and love, full of suspenseful moments and first-rate: sleuthing." --New York World Telegram "Grade A (make it A-plus). mysterious, rich in atmosphere." -- New York Herald Tribune ; FINE.
